Terence Harden is a scholar working on Plant Science, Food Science and Biotechnology. According to data from OpenAlex, Terence Harden has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 459 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Plant Science, 4 papers in Food Science and 3 papers in Biotechnology. Recurrent topics in Terence Harden's work include Plant-Microbe Interactions and Immunity (4 papers), Plant Pathogens and Resistance (4 papers) and Legume Nitrogen Fixing Symbiosis (3 papers). Terence Harden is often cited by papers focused on Plant-Microbe Interactions and Immunity (4 papers), Plant Pathogens and Resistance (4 papers) and Legume Nitrogen Fixing Symbiosis (3 papers). Terence Harden collaborates with scholars based in Australia, Ukraine and United States. Terence Harden's co-authors include K. R. Helyar, Wayne Pitt, S. Simpfendorfer, K M Kam, G. M. Murray, Ailsa D. Hocking, Mark S. Hibbins, Robert C. Pritchard, D. B. Muir and Stuart Helliwell and has published in prestigious journals such as Soil Biology and Biochemistry, Antimicrobial Agents and Chemotherapy and The Medical Journal of Australia.
